Reseña del editor:

Brain Storm is the deeply personal and inspirational account of the survivor of a brain tumor – a tumor the size of an orange. Be encouraged as Edith shares how faith and family helped her through the diagnosis, treatment and recovery. Be prepared to laugh and cry as Edith's shares her remarkable journey. Doctors and nurses were transformed through Edith's supernatural experiences; you will be too! Brain Storm will teach you...

  • How faith grounds you when trauma comes to derail your dreams
  • How being rooted and grounded in faith will carry you through the crisis
  • How family is a critical part of rehabilitation
  • How having a positive attitude works in your favor
  • How your testimony can help you and others to overcome

Biografía del autor:
EDITH DOSS-JONES has made major contributions to society and individuals through her leadership role in the Young Life Campaign. She provided critical support to many Christian ministries, churches and non-profit organizations as Outreach Manager for World Vision, an international, non-profit, relief and development organization. Edith also provided partner organizations with new products and financial resources, which increased and supported neighborhood effectiveness. Now retired, in 2011, Edith earned a B.S. degree in Sociology – fulfilling a lifelong goal.
